Surety Contract Bonds Are Pricey
Guaranty agreement bonds aren't always expensive, in contrast to popular belief. Many people presume that acquiring a guaranty bond for an agreement will lead to large prices. Nevertheless, this isn't necessarily the situation.
The price of a guaranty bond is figured out by various elements, such as the kind of bond, the bond quantity, and the danger involved. https://www.palmbeachpost.com/story/news/2023/01/23/palm-beach-county-a-bigger-favorite-of-new-york-transplants-after-covid/69790200007/ is very important to recognize that guaranty bond costs are a tiny percentage of the bond quantity, normally ranging from 1% to 15%.
In addition, the financial stability and credit reliability of the specialist play a significant role in determining the bond costs. So, if you have an excellent credit history and a strong monetary standing, you might be able to protect a surety contract bond at a reasonable cost.

Surety Contract Bonds Coincide as Insurance
Unlike common belief, there's a crucial difference between guaranty agreement bonds and insurance policy. While both give a type of economic protection, they serve various objectives in the world of business.
Surety agreement bonds are specifically made to ensure the performance of a service provider or a business on a project. They make certain that the service provider satisfies their contractual responsibilities and finishes the job as agreed upon.
On the other hand, insurance coverage protect versus unforeseen events and supply protection for losses or problems. Insurance coverage is suggested to make up policyholders for losses that occur due to crashes, theft, or various other protected occasions.
